Ingredients for Long Stem Broccoli Recipe
- 1 lb Long Stem Broccoli, trimmed and cut into 1-inch pieces
- 2 tbsp Olive Oil
- 1 tsp Garlic Powder
- 1/2 tsp Onion Powder
- 1/4 tsp Red Pepper Flakes (optional)
- Sal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ste
- 1 tbsp Lemon Juice
High-quality olive oil adds a subtle richness to the dish. Garlic powder and onion powder add depth of flavour. Red pepper flakes offer a touch of heat, if desired. Salt and pepper enhance the natural sweetness of the broccoli. Lemon juice provides a bright, tangy finish.

Substitutions: Substitute butter for olive oil for a richer flavour. Substitute different herbs for the powders, such as oregano or thyme. If you do not have lemon juice, a squeeze of lime juice works well as a substitute.
Step-by-Step Preparation of Long Stem Broccoli Recipe
- Blanch the broccoli florets in boiling water for 2-3 minutes until tender-crisp, then immediately transfer to an ice bath to stop the cooking process. This step is crucial to preserving the vibrant green colour and tender-crisp texture.
- Heat the olive oil in a large skillet or wok over medium heat. Ensure the oil is hot enough to sizzle when you add the broccoli.
- Add the blanched broccoli to the hot oil. Stir-fry for 3-4 minutes, until heated through and slightly softened. The goal is to maintain a tender-crisp texture.
- Sprinkle with garlic powder, onion powder, red pepper flakes (if using), salt, and pepper. Stir to coat evenly.
- Add the lemon juice and stir again. Cook for another minute, until the lemon juice has infused the broccoli and the flavours have melded together.
- Serve immediately as a side dish or as part of a main course.
Tips & Troubleshooting, Long Stem Broccoli Recipe
If the broccoli becomes too mushy, reduce the cooking time. If the broccoli is not heated through, increase the cooking time.

- Question: Can I use frozen broccoli?
- Answer: Yes, you can use frozen broccoli. However, omit the blanching step. Add the frozen broccoli directly to the hot oil and proceed with the recipe.
- Question: How long can I store leftover broccoli?
- Answer: Leftover broccoli can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.

What are some tips for achieving a tender-crisp texture?

Proper blanching or steaming followed by a short sautéing period helps maintain a tender-crisp texture. Adjust cooking time based on the thickness of the broccoli stems for optimal results.
